Syria talks to start in Kazakhstan’s capital on January 23
Talks between the Syrian Government and opposition groups will begin in Astana, Kazakhstan, on January 23, Turkish Foreign Minister Mevlut Cavusoglu said on January 4. He also said that Russian experts are expected to arrive in Turkey on January 9-10 to discuss the forthcoming Syrian negotiations in the capital of…

Turkey eyes trilateral format with Azerbaijan and Kazakhstan
Turkey is working to create an Azerbaijan-Turkey-Kazakhstan trilateral format, the Turkish Foreign Minister Mevlut Cavusoglu said. According to the minister, trilateral formats created by Turkey in the Caucasus and Balkan regions operate very efficiently, TRT Haber news channel reports. Bird flu under control after culling 30 million chickens, ducks
Acting President and Prime Minister of South Korea, Hwang Kyo-ahn said Tuesday that the spread of avian influenza (AI) that has ravaged poultry farms across the country since mid-November has almost been brought under control.
